Permission to erect (1) a steel framed agricultural shed for machinery storage

Refused

Core Refusal Reason

Failure to demonstrate compliance with the European Union (Good Agricultural Practice for Protection of Waters) Regulations 2022 due to insufficient and inconsistent documentation regarding nutrient management and site drainage.

Decision Maker's Conclusion

  • The applicant failed to provide an up-to-date Nutrient Management Plan and farmyard management plan necessary to verify compliance with S.I. No. 113 of 2022 (GAP Regulations).
  • Significant inconsistencies exist between the submitted site layout maps and the Nutrient Management Plan, particularly regarding the management of slurry, soiled water, and clean water flows.
  • The absence of detailed surface water disposal routes and verified livestock data (Nitrogen & Phosphorus statements) prevents a determination that the development would not negatively impact the environment.

Decision Document Summary

The proposal sought permission for a steel-framed agricultural shed for machinery storage at Ballaghboy, Gorey Rural. The application was refused because the planning authority determined that the applicant failed to provide sufficient technical evidence to ensure the farming enterprise complies with water protection regulations.
